Back End Software Engineer
Back End Software Engineer Department: Engineering Employment Type: Full Time Location: London, UK Compensation: £57,000 - £75,000 / year
Description The Team
The Engineering team at FundApps is a team of ca. 50 smart, friendly people who collaborate closely and take pride in delivering best-in-class software and providing an extraordinary experience to our clients. We’re solving some of the most challenging problems in financial services - we operate in petabytes and milliseconds, not optimising the upload of cat photos. Our clients use our service for multiple hours a day - what we do as engineers has a real life impact on thousands of people across the globe!
Our team values are professionalism, sustainability, and psychological safety; we hold each other to high standards, give each other considered and constructive feedback, work smart, and look out for each other. Learn more about our engineering culture here.
The Role
As part of the engineering team, you'll be working on a suite of innovative products that monitor over US$20 trillion in assets under management every single day, used by some of the world's largest Investment Managers. We are looking for a Mid-Level Back End Engineer who can help drive innovation and deliver great software at pace while also keeping sustainability in mind. We need highly motivated, intelligent people hungry for a challenge.
At FundApps, you'll see the inner workings of a fast-growing, bootstrapped scaleup where we expect all Engineers to take responsibility for their part in our success, seek support when needed, and care equally about our products and client outcomes as you do about writing code. We solve business problems through technology, not just ship code.
We like keeping our tech stack modern and are not afraid to invest to keep it cutting edge! As such we’ve recently completed major projects which included distributing our main rules engine using AWS services, migrated terabytes of data from SQL server to Aurora Postgres, replaced our Single Sign On service with Auth0 and converted our frontend to React.
Our Tech Stack Back-end: C# Data storage: PostgreSQL; Amazon storage including Aurora, DynamoDB, S3 Infrastructure: Terraform and AWS, using Fargate, Lambdas, Step functions, and a lot more! Pipeline: GitHub Actions, TeamCity, Octopus Deploy, Serverless Front-end: React, TypeScript
How We Work FundApps engineers have a lot of freedom to solve problems in a way that achieves our outcomes, and works within our values. You will not be micro-managed - in fact, it's the opposite - you will be expected to take ownership of your work from Day 1. To thrive at FundApps, you will need to be comfortable with uncertainty, and embrace change as it comes. We value people who take charge of their destiny and help make things better for everyone around them. We release software when it's ready, not on a schedule - our teams deploy multiple times a day.

We work agile, but do not follow any approach blindly - we seek 1% improvements in everything we do, try new things but don't hold to anything too tightly. Fundamentally, we follow a Kanban-inspired approach, but we also take inspiration from Team Topologies, 12-factor, DevOps culture - and all the good agile practices that you have read about. At FundApps we put these practices to work, reflect, and iterate to make sure our practices continue to serve us well.
Our Engineers look after a wide set of products and technical services; we don't strictly follow a micro-services approach, however we are working over time to evolve our codebase and our core technology to be distributed, cloud-native and resource- and cost-effective to power our growth while doing our bit to help FundApps be carbon neutral.
What You'll Bring To The Team Background: You are a mid engineer with generalist knowledge of product development concepts (software design, product requirements, work breakdown) and agile practices (TDD, CI/CD, architecture) and can apply them to solve well-defined problems independently and with your team. You are comfortable writing code in C#, Java or Python. Work-with-purpose: You can articulate the value of your own work in larger projects or team-wide goals. You have the space to own and deliver solutions and are comfortable working with ambiguity and evolving requirements. Have-courage: You are comfortable asking for and giving feedback. You help others when needed, and participate in debates, brainstorms, and other team conversations regularly. You build good relationships with your colleagues in Engineering, Product, and the wider company and are able to respectfully challenge each other to understand the problem and come up with the best solutions. As a company, we embrace change and the chance of failure. Be-transparent: As a company, we value and aspire for transparency at all levels; you’ll provide work updates to communicate regularly about progress and blockers and reach out for help when needed. Raise-the-bar: You seek out opportunities to improve our code, process, and practices; 1% improvements over time improve things for everyone. Do-more-with-less: You identify and help implement improvements to processes and standards within the team, seek to optimise our workflow, and share ideas for how to automate manual tasks. As a company we try to minimise meetings (we have meeting-free Wednesdays) and default to asynchronous written communication over long multiple person meetings.

A Few Things To Know Before You Apply Salary
We are currently hiring across multiple levels and base salary for this role is between £57,000 - £75,000. The final offer will be made based on your experience and your performance during the interview process.
Work Eligibility
We require candidates to have permission to work in the UK without visa sponsorship.
We work hybrid and ask that new FundAppers spend 3 days per week at our shiny London office during their first 6 months, to make the most of getting to know the business and other FundAppers.
After that, our policy is at least 2 days per week in the office to collaborate, connect and make the most of our shared space.
Life at FundApps
🕐 Work/life balance with flexible hybrid working 💚 Wellbeing benefits such as private health insurance, life insurance, a flexible stipend and mental health coaching 💰 Matched pension contribution up to 10% 💰 Peer micro-bonuses through Bonusly 🎓 £1,000 learning budget each year and unlimited professional development leave 💡 Peer-led ‘Brown-bag lunch’ learning sessions and an annual Learning Festival 🚢 25 days holiday leave + an extra day next year if you use it all + an extra day after 3 & 5 years 🧳 5 Years @ FundApps - additional 4 weeks paid holiday leave during your 5th year as a FundApper 👶 26 weeks leave for all new parents regardless of gender, location or family structure ❤️ Volunteering leave 🎁 Birthday off
